environment definition - medical

en·vi·ron·ment (ĕn-vīˈrən-mənt, -vīˈərn-)

noun
The totality of circumstances surrounding an organism or group of organisms, especially the combination of external physical conditions that affect and influence the growth, development, and survival of organisms.

Related Forms:

  • en·viˌron·menˈtal (-mĕnˈtl) adjective
